i used Carbon Copy Cloner to create a clone of my internal HD to an external usb hd, now if something happens and my internal drive gets corrupted how do i boot from the usb drive?
The key to answering that is to ask whether or not you have an Intel based Mac.
Intel machines will boot fine from USB drives, assuming they are formatted as Mac OS Extended (Journaled) and have been prepared with a GUID partition map. Intel machines will also boot from FireWire drives- but again with the correct format/partition map.
PowerPC Macs (although there are a couple of late model exceptions) will only boot from FireWire drives with a partition map type of APM (Apple Partition Map)- not GUID.
